What happens

Mangoes is a Pakistani Canadian television series directed by Khurram Suhrwardy and produced by Adeel Suhrwardy and Khurram Suhrwardy under the production banner of Suhrwardy Brothers. The story revolves around the lives of young South Asians living in Canada. The series was first premiered on 27 June 2012 on ATN Canada and it ended after seven episodes. The second season began on 29 September 2016 on ATN. The third season Mangoes: a slice of life began in September 2019 on YouTube. (from Wikipedia, CC BY-SA)
